Understanding the Waste Management Crisis
Before delving into innovative solutions, it's crucial to understand the magnitude of the waste management crisis. According to the World Bank, the global waste generation is expected to increase from 2.01 billion tonnes in 2016 to 3.40 billion tonnes in 2050. This alarming trend underscores the urgent need for innovative waste management strategies.
Innovative Ideas for Waste Management
1. Upcycling: Turning Waste into Valuable Products
Upcycling involves transforming waste materials into new, high-quality products. This process reduces waste, conserves natural resources, and creates unique, eco-friendly products. For instance, Dutch designer Dave Hakkens created a 3D-printed chair from recycled plastic waste, demonstrating the potential of upcycling.

2. Circular Economy: Eliminating Waste
The circular economy is a model that aims to eliminate waste and the continual use of resources. It focuses on designing out waste and pollution, keeping products and materials in use, and regenerating natural systems. Companies like Philips and Desso have successfully implemented circular economy models, reducing waste and saving costs.
3. Biogas: Converting Organic Waste into Energy
Biogas is a renewable energy source produced from the decomposition of organic matter. It can be used to generate electricity, heat, or even fuel vehicles. By converting organic waste into biogas, we can reduce methane emissions from landfills and create a valuable energy source. Sweden's biogas production has increased significantly, demonstrating the potential of this technology.
4. Waste-to-Energy: Incinerating Waste for Power
Waste-to-energy (WtE) facilities burn waste to generate electricity, steam, or both. While not a perfect solution due to emissions, WtE can help reduce the amount of waste sent to landfills and generate renewable energy. Japan and Sweden are among the countries that have successfully implemented WtE plants.

5. Recycling Technologies: Improving Recycling Rates
Innovative recycling technologies can significantly improve recycling rates and reduce contamination. For example, the automated sorting system at the Materials Recovery Facility in San Francisco can sort 80 different types of materials, increasing the city's recycling rate to over 80%.
6. The Internet of Things (IoT) and Smart Waste Management
The IoT can revolutionize waste management by providing real-time data on waste levels, collection schedules, and route optimization. Sensors and smart bins can help reduce collection costs, improve efficiency, and minimize environmental impact. Companies like Sensoneo and BinCam are already implementing IoT solutions for waste management.
